Two Prosecutors

(Zwei Staatsanwälte)


The latest film from the great Ukrainian director Sergei Loznita (My Joy) is a scalpel-precise tale of the horror of totalitarian bureaucracy.

Soviet Union, 1937. Thousands of letters from detainees falsely accused by the regime are burned in a prison cell. Against all odds, one of them reaches its destination, upon the desk of the newly appointed local prosecutor, Alexander Kornev.

Kornev does his utmost to meet the prisoner, a victim of corrupt agents of the secret police, the NKVD. A dedicated Bolshevik of integrity, the young prosecutor suspects foul play. His quest for justice will take him all the way to the office of the Attorney General in Moscow.

In the age of the great Stalinist purges, this is the plunge of a man into the corridors of a totalitarian regime that does not bear said name.

Palme d'Or Nominee, Cannes Film Festival 2025
